Toronto vs. Ottawa

 

Toronto Maple Leafs and Ottawa Senators came face-to-face on October 5, 2021. Seeing both the teams playing against each other was quite interesting. The first period of the match started with the face-off between Colin White and David Kampf. By the end of the first period, there was no goal by any of the teams. Then in the next half, the match had a good start and ended with one goal each for both the teams. In the third and final period, Toronto took a comprehensive lead over Ottawa. This concluded the match and made Toronto Maple Leafs the winner with a 3-1 scoreline. After this exciting match, it's time for both teams to compete with each other once again. Vegas vs. Los Angeles

 

Another match everyone is excited to watch is Vegas (Golden Knights) vs. Los Angeles (Kings). These teams competed against each other on October 2, 2021, where Vegas defeated Los Angeles with a 4-0. In the first period, Vegas managed to take the lead. Then, in the next half, Los Angeles trailed once again as Vegas scored one more goal. In the third and final round, Vegas got two goals, and Los Angeles got none. This concluded the whole match. In total, Vegas scored four goals while Los Angeles scored zero.
